In this comprehensive study of porcelain, art historian Edward Dillon traces the history of the medium from ancient China to modern Europe. Dillon explores techniques for creating and decorating porcelain, and provides detailed examinations of notable works and styles throughout history. Illustrated with numerous photographs and diagrams, this volume is an essential resource for those interested in the history of decorative arts.
